DROP RLS POLICY - Amazon Redshift

Amazon Redshift non supporterà più la creazione di nuove UDF Python a partire dal 1º novembre 2025. Se desideri utilizzare le UDF Python, creale prima di tale data. Le UDF Python esistenti continueranno a funzionare normalmente. Per ulteriori informazioni, consulta il post del blog.

DROP RLS POLICY

Elimina una policy di sicurezza a livello di riga per tutte le tabelle in tutti i database.

Una policy può essere eliminata da superuser e utenti o ruoli che dispongono del ruolo sys:secadmin.

Sintassi

DROP RLS POLICY [ IF EXISTS ] policy_name [ CASCADE | RESTRICT ]

Parametri

IF EXISTS

Una clausola che indica se la policy specificata esiste già.

nome_policy

Nome della policy.

CASCADE

Una clausola che indica di scollegare automaticamente la policy da tutte le tabelle collegate prima di eliminarla.

RESTRICT

Una clausola che indica di non eliminare la policy quando viene collegata ad alcune tabelle. Questa è l’impostazione predefinita.

Esempi

Nell'esempio seguente viene eliminata la policy di sicurezza a livello di riga.

DROP RLS POLICY policy_concerts;